The landscape of entertainment shifts constantly. We are witnessing the rise of a unique hybrid genre: the . This term bridges traditional cinema with the structural magic of situational comedies (sitcoms).
"Hitcom" is often used as a shorthand for "hit comedy." These are films that successfully translate the beloved elements of television sitcoms—relatable characters, witty banter, and situational humor—into a feature-length format.

The term "Hitcom" is a fascinating piece of media jargon. It's a compound word, or a portmanteau, that combines "Hit," meaning a great success, and "Sitcom," an abbreviation for "Situation Comedy". Therefore, a hitcom is not merely a sitcom; it is a highly successful, popular, and often long-running situation comedy series, predominantly produced for television. While the term originated in American media journalism, it has since been adopted globally to describe those rare shows that transcend typical success to become cultural phenomena.
